Setting Time and Date [Time & Date]

Changing the Time and Date

While the recorder is during stop mode, press and
hold the STOP 4 button to display the Time and
Date, Remaining Memory and File Format.
22:38
If the Time and Date is not correct, set it using the
procedure below.
1
While the recorder is during stop
mode, press the MENU button.
2
Press the 2 or 3 button to select
[Time & Date].
3
Press the `/OK or 9 button.
The following steps are the same as Step 1
through Step 3 of "Setting Time and Date
[Time & Date]" (☞ P.12).
4
Press the MENU button to close the
menu screen.
